Output 21c63344d76934407e9879c6f7ff816794d8e9b9b004a420131f2bac816c0fcc:1

value
5295439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09de037930dfa569ce6a424c28192e65b7743e7b OP_EQUAL
address
32bBy3U8DQv8m7eQz2fxqvybn46HFDfaKD
transaction
21c63344d76934407e9879c6f7ff816794d8e9b9b004a420131f2bac816c0fcc